How to Choose a Luxury Sofa for Your Dubai Home

A sofa is often the single largest furniture investment in a UAE living room, and the choice goes far beyond fabric colour. Frame construction is the first thing to check — kiln-dried hardwood frames resist warping in air-conditioned interiors far better than softwood or particleboard alternatives common in mass-market pieces.
Leather grading matters just as much. Full-grain and top-grain leathers age gracefully and develop a natural patina, while bonded or 'PU leather' options tend to crack within a few years, especially near sunlit windows. If you're set on fabric, look for high rub-count performance weaves that resist pilling.
Cushion fill is the third pillar: high-density foam wrapped in down or fibre blend gives a sofa the plush-yet-supportive feel associated with hospitality-grade furniture, and it holds its shape far longer than foam alone.
Finally, consider scale. Open-plan Dubai apartments and villa majlis spaces can accommodate larger modular or sectional layouts — but always measure doorways, lifts, and stairwells before ordering a made-to-order piece, since custom furniture is rarely returnable.
